AN UNUSUAL HUANGHUALI RECTANGULAR BOX, TRAY AND COVER
17TH CENTURY
Of rectangular form, raised on short feet with integral aprons, the removable center section carved in openwork with confronted chilong and forming the sides of the tray when the cover is removed, the edges set with huangtong fittings, with those on the cover of ruyi- head form and those on the sides left plain
6 3/8 in. (15.7 cm.) high, 18 11/16 in. (47.5 cm.) wide, 11¾ in. (29.9 cm.) deep
